Understanding Pediatric Nursing



Pediatric nursing is a specialized area of nursing that focuses on the care of infants, children, and adolescents. It encompasses a range of responsibilities, from assessing and diagnosing health issues to implementing treatment plans and educating families about health and wellness. Pediatric nurses must possess a unique set of skills and knowledge to address the specific needs of their young patients, including understanding developmental stages, communicating effectively with children and parents, and managing acute and chronic conditions.

How to Effectively Use the Wong Essentials of Pediatric Nursing Test Bank



To maximize the benefits of the Wong Essentials of Pediatric Nursing Test Bank, students should consider the following strategies:


  1. Regular Review: Incorporate the test bank into your study routine by scheduling regular review sessions. This consistent practice will help reinforce your knowledge.

  2. Simulate Testing Conditions: Take practice tests in a timed setting to improve your time management skills and familiarize yourself with the pressure of exam conditions.

  3. Focus on Weak Areas: After completing practice questions, review the topics where you struggled. Use additional resources to deepen your understanding of these areas.

  4. Group Study: Consider forming study groups with classmates. Discussing questions and concepts with peers can enhance comprehension and retention.

  5. Seek Feedback: If possible, discuss your answers and thought processes with instructors or mentors who can provide valuable feedback and guidance.
